3RD ANNUAL RAIN BIRD INTELLIGENT USE OF WATER AWARDS NOW OPEN FOR NOMINATIONS
Annual Awards Program Recognizes Leaders in Landscape Water Conservation; New State of The Union Award Recognizes Outstanding Achievements in Landscape Water Conservation by State/Local Municipalities and Water Agencies
AZUSA, CA (May 18, 2009) -
Rain Bird Corporation, the leading manufacturer and provider of irrigation products and services, announced today that it is seeking nominations for the 2009 Intelligent Use of WaterÔ Awards. The annual Leadership award recognizes individuals or organizations whose innovation, leadership, ingenuity and dedication to the management and protection of earth’s most precious natural resource through improved landscape water efficiency has raised the standard for outdoor water conservation.
In addition, U.S. municipalities and states with city- or state-wide water conservation programs are invited to nominate themselves for Rain Bird’s inaugural “State of The Union” award, recognizing outstanding achievements in landscape water management by public water management entities.
Intelligent Use of Water Leadership Award
Open to both consumers and professionals, the Intelligent Use of Water Leadership Award honors persons or organizations whose innovation, leadership, ingenuity and implementation of landscape water-efficiency practices has raised the standard for outdoor water conservation. Following the close of the nomination period (July 31, 2009), an independent panel of judges will select five finalists. The recipient of the 2009 Intelligent Use of Water Leadership Award will be awarded $10,000 and will be featured in a short film highlighting their contributions to outdoor water conservation. The award will be presented and the film shown at the WaterSmart Innovations Conference in Las Vegas, Nevada, October 7-10, 2009.
Intelligent Use of Water State of The Union Award
The Intelligent Use of Water State of The Union Award will recognize city and state municipalities and water agencies that excel in implementing effective landscape water-efficiency and conservation programs and initiatives. Following the close of the nominations period (July 31, 2009), five winners will be selected by an independent panel of judges and announced at the WaterSmart Innovations Conference in Las Vegas, Nevada, October 7-10. These winners will also be awarded positions as panelists on Rain Bird’s Intelligent Use of Water Summit XI, to be held at the Smithsonian Institution in Washington, D.C., in April 2010. As panelists, they will have the opportunity to showcase their award-winning case study to an audience of U.S. and international water management leaders.

ABOUT RAIN BIRD CORPORATION
Based in Azusa, CA, Rain Bird Corporation is the leading
manufacturer and provider of irrigation products and services.
Since its beginnings in 1933, Rain Bird has offered the industry’s
broadest range of irrigation products for farms, golf courses,
sports arenas, commercial developments and homes in more
than 130 countries around the world. Rain Bird has been awarded
more than 130 patents, including the first in 1935 for the
impact sprinkler. Rain Bird and The Intelligent Use of Water™ is
about using water wisely. Its commitment extends beyond products
to education, training and services for the industry and
the community. Rain Bird maintains state-of-the-art manufacturing
assembly facilities in the United States, France, Sweden
